Rhodopsin-containing … Web31 mrt. 2024 · How is rhodopsin formed? It is made up of opsin (a colourless protein) and 11-cis-retinal (11-cis-retinaldehyde), a pigmented molecule derived from vitamin A. When the eye is exposed to light, the 11-cis-retinal component of rhodopsin is converted to all-trans-retinal, resulting in a fundamental change in the configuration of the rhodopsin

WebRhodopsin expression is essential for the formation of the ROS, which are absent in knockout rhodopsin−/− mice (36, 37). The ROS of mice heterozygous for the rhodopsin gene deletion (rhodopsin+/−) have a similar density of rhodopsin, but the ROS volume is reduced by ~60% compared with wild-type mice ( 33 ).
